Stone Floor Installation in Wilmington, NC
Stone floor installation services involve the placement and setting of natural stone materials to create durable, attractive surfaces for various areas within a property. This service is commonly requested for projects such as entryways, patios, walkways, kitchen floors, and other high-traffic or outdoor spaces. Homeowners often seek guidance on the different types of stone available, including granite, slate, limestone, and marble, to determine which best suits their aesthetic preferences and functional needs. Additionally, property owners usually want to understand the preparation process, including surface leveling and foundation requirements, to ensure a long-lasting and visually appealing result.
Before requesting stone floor installation, property owners should consider factors such as the location of the project, the level of foot traffic, and maintenance requirements for different stone types. It’s helpful to clarify whether the installation will be indoor or outdoor, as some stones are better suited for certain environments. Understanding the overall design vision, budget, and timeline can also assist in selecting the right materials and planning the project effectively. Proper planning and informed choices can contribute to a durable, attractive stone surface that enhances the property's value and curb appeal.

Stone Floor Installation Questions
What types of stone are suitable for floor installation? Common options include marble, granite, slate, and limestone,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ities for indoor or outdoor spaces.
How should a stone floor be prepared before installation? The subfloor must be level, clean, and stable to ensure proper adhesion and longevity of the stone surface.
Can stone floors be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, stone can often be installed over existing concrete or tile, provided the surface is in good condition and properly prepared.
What maintenance is required for stone floors? Regular cleaning with suitable products and sealing periodically helps maintain the appearance and durability of stone flooring.
